Term of the Moment

high-frequency trading

Look Up Another Term

Definition: microblog

A blog that contains brief entries about the daily activities of an individual or company. Created to keep friends, colleagues and customers up-to-date, small images may be included as well as brief audio and video clips. The most popular microblogs are X/Twitter and Tumblr. See blog, Twitter and Tumblr.